About us

Dr. Mark Warshofsky is the Senior Vice President & System Chair of the Nuvance Health Heart and Vascular Institute and the Yoriko McClure Endowed Chair in Heart and Vascular. He received his medical degree with distinction from the George Washington University School of Medicine in Washington, DC. After completing internal medicine training at New York-Presbyterian Hospital, he completed fellowships in cardiology and interventional cardiology at Columbia University College of Physicians and Surgeons. Dr. Warshofsky is the founding director of the cardiovascular disease fellowship at Danbury Hospital and maintains an active role in medical education. His clinical interests include coronary artery and valvular heart disease, and his research focuses on acute coronary syndromes and stress cardiomyopathy. He is a Fellow of the American College of Cardiology and is board certified in cardiovascular disease and interventional cardiology.
